Claims
- 1. A portably extendable and retractable telescoping stabilizing support system for receiving and dynamically balancing a plurality of elements during use, the support system comprising:an elongated main support member, having a distal end adapted to adjustably receive and removably secure a primary support system, a proximal end adapted to adjustably receive and removably secure the main support member to a secondary support system, and a gimbal means adjustably positioned at the stabilizing support system's center of gravity wherein; the primary support system is telescopically extendable and retractable from within the main support member, having a distal end and a proximal end, comprising at least one telescoping primary support member slidably movable to a predetermined distance from within the main support member between the retracted position and the extended position, and an element support means removably secured on the distal end of the primary support member furthest remote from the main support member to adjustably receive and removably secure an element in a predetermined position; the secondary support system, having a distal end and a proximal end, comprising a base support member, at least one telescoping secondary support member within which the main support member is telescopically extendable and retractable, said secondary support member being extendable and retractable from within the base support member, a base at the secondary support system's proximal end removably secured to the base support member and comprising a means for movably and fixedly positioning a plurality of elements, wherein each element is adjustably and removably securable thereto and wherein at least one element is adjustably moveable along either the main support system or the secondary support system, for counterbalancing and maintaining dynamic balance of the support system; and an adjustably and removably securable viewing element; whereby rotational inertia of the stabilizing support system can be increased in a pan axis as the adjustably secured elements are oriented in relation to the telescopically extendable and retractable support members to maintain the support system balance.
- 2. The stabilizing support system of claim 1 wherein the primary support system comprises a plurality of telescoping primary support members wherein each member's diameter decreases in relation to a member's distance from the main support member.
- 3. The stabilizing support system of claim 2, wherein the telescoping primary support members are adapted to sequentially slide into each other, such that each successive member is slidably moveable into the next largest member.
- 4. The stabilizing support system of claim 2 wherein a proximal end of the telescoping primary member nearest the main support member is extendable and retractable from within the distal end of the main support member.
- 5. The stabilizing support system of claim 1, wherein the element positioned on the element support means is an adjustable and removably securable camera.
- 6. The stabilizing support system of claim 5, wherein the element support means is an angularly adjustable and pivotally tiltable camera support means.
- 7. The stabilizing support system of claim 1, wherein one of said plurality of elements of the secondary support system is an adjustable and removably securable viewing means.
- 8. The stabilizing support system of claim 7, wherein the viewing means is an adjustable and removably securable monitor.
- 9. The stabilizing support system of claim 1, wherein one of said plurality of elements of the secondary support system is an adjustable and removably securable mass.
- 10. The stabilizing support system of claim 9, wherein the mass is an adjustable and removably securable battery.
- 11. The stabilizing support system of claim 1, wherein the base support member is an annular cylinder adjustable to receive a proximal end of the secondary support member.
- 12. The stabilizing support system of claim 11, wherein the cylinder has an open longitudinal section to allow access for adjustment, insertion and removal of the secondary support member into the cylinder.
